I visited Indulge yesterday with some family for a nice evening and good food.
Service was just "okay", but we really enjoyed the restaurant's concept and the level of control we had over the taste of our burgers. Here's how it works:
Upon being seated, you are given a checklist of ingrediants that allows you to customize every detail of your burger. For example, everyone at my table chose a different type of bun - and I even chose to have my (veggie) burger placed over a salad as opposed to ordering a bun at all.
The food took a litle while to come out, but it was worth it. The portions are massive (I got a to-go box) which justifies the high prices.
---The Bar
After my meal I sat at the bar to finish watching the Sunday Night Football game on one of their two televisions. The bar was full and kinda crammed. Hard to hold a private conversation. I wasn't really expecting them to even have a bar, so it was cool to see that they were playing the Cardinals game on TV. The happy hour prices are pretty good depending on what day of the week you go. And their beer selection is local, with Four Peaks and Sleepy Dog options.
Though I wouldn't ever suggest going to this place exclusively to watch a game or have a beer, it's nice to know that it's an option whenever you come to grab a good burger.
